2 <br />July 22,1998, Plan Commission Minutes Page 2 <br />Hearing: resubdivision / condominium, 7012 Forsyth <br />Vice Chairperson Glassman announced that a hearing was scheduled to consider the application <br />of 7012 Forsyth Blvd., Inc., represented by Richard Keefe for final plat approval to resubdivide a <br />six-family building into six condominiums at 7012 Forsyth to be known as the 7012 Forsyth <br />Condominiums. <br />Mr. Hill gave the staff recommendation that the application be approved per his July 14, 1998 <br />memo. <br />Richard Keefe, 7012 Forsyth, University City, MO 63105, gave an overview of the project and <br />asked to have the application approved. <br />Ms. Peniston moved that the Plan Commission recommend approval of the final plat for the 7012 <br />Forsyth Condominiums. The motion was seconded by Mr. Reed and passed by a vote of 4 to 0, <br />with all members voting “aye” (Mr. Price was not present during this agenda item). <br />Hearing: resubdivision, Schnucks University City Sq.
